With three teams sharing a league title, there were plenty of awards to hand out.

 

North Kitsap, North Mason and Port Townsend all shared the Olympic League title and all three took home most of the boys all-league honors.

 

North Kitsap's Kyle Erickson was named Olympic League MVP after averaging 17.6 points, 3.4 assists and 2.5 steals on Friday and teammate Taylor Hoffer joined him on the first team.

 

Larry Skogstad earned coach of the year with his son Brett taking first-team honors.

 

Port Townsend had forward Parker McClelland on the first team and point guard Dakotah Pine on the second team.

 

Olympic's Larry Dixon and Klahowya's Andre Moore each were all-league at guard. Both were all-league in football, too. Moore led the area in scoring at 24.1 points per game.

 

Port Angeles' Jessica Madison earned girls MVP honors after leading the area with 22.3 points per game.
